Blue-faced Masked Booby, which is a seabird species. The Blue-faced Masked Booby (Sula dactylatra) is a large seabird that inhabits tropical and subtropical regions. Here are some key characteristics and information about this bird Appearance: The Blue-faced Masked Booby is a relatively large seabird with a distinctive appearance. It has a white body with black wings and tail. As the name suggests, its most noticeable feature is its bright blue facial skin, which contrasts starkly with its white body. Range: Blue-faced Masked Boobies are found in the Pacific Ocean and the Indian Ocean, particularly around tropical and subtropical islands. They are known to breed on remote islands and atolls. Feeding: These boobies are excellent divers and feed primarily on fish and other marine creatures. They use their sharp beaks to catch prey underwater.
